Join this passionate State Government Department and help to deliver a full range of internal and external strategic communication and stakeholder engagement services as their newest Senior Officer. Use your skills to provide specialist advice and services across community consultation, communications and engagement strategies, customer information and issues management.
What's involved?
- Develop, implement, and evaluate communication and stakeholder engagement strategies and plans.
- Devise, coordinate, deliver and evaluate the effectiveness of events, workshops, and community consultation activities.
- Take a lead role working with team members to develop and maintain an integrated regional communications project milestones list/calendar while managing communications activities to time, cost, and budget.
- Contribute to the implementation of a program of building community awareness by facilitating meetings and forums and identifying ways to assist the community participate in infrastructure projects.
- Provide strategic advice and participate in, and on occasion lead, our clients communities of practice to improve and enhance the delivery of communication services to the community.
- Build and maintain working relationships with internal and external stakeholders.
What do we need from you?
- Demonstrated ability to develop, deliver and evaluate stakeholder engagement strategies, including experience in conducting public meetings and forums and using a wide range of engagement tools.
- Proven ability to proactively identify, manage and resolve conflict and issues on complex, high profile projects while working in a politically sensitive environment.
- Proven experience managing multiple external stakeholders combined with sound experience in managing project communications.
- Experience in developing communications plans involving community consultation and engagement.
- Demonstrated achievement in the development and implementation of innovative communications, issues management, information provision and stakeholder and community engagement strategies.
